Key Ingredients & Substitutions

Watermelon: The hero of this salad! Choose ripe, sweet seedless watermelon for the best flavor. You can swap this for cantaloupe or honeydew if you can’t find watermelon, but they will offer a different taste.

Cilantro: Fresh cilantro adds a zesty flavor. If you’re not a fan, try fresh mint or basil for a different twist. Just remember, those herbs will change the flavor profile a bit!

Red Chili: Adjust the amount of chili based on your heat preference. For a milder spice, use jalapeño or omit completely. If you love heat, add more or use a spicier chili like habanero.

Lime Juice: Fresh lime juice brightens up the salad. In a pinch, bottled lime juice works too, but fresh is best! You can also use lemon juice if needed.

Feta Cheese: Adding feta gives a creamy texture. If you’re avoiding dairy, try crumbled tofu or leave it out entirely for a lighter salad.

How Do I Get The Best Flavor from My Watermelon?

Getting the most flavor out of watermelon is all about ripeness and seasoning. Choose the sweetest watermelon you can. For the best flavor balance, let your salad chill for 15-20 minutes—this allows the flavors to mix and develop!

  • Mix the watermelon and veggies gently to keep the watermelon intact.
  • Experiment with the dressing! Start with lime juice, olive oil, salt, and a sprinkle of chili powder.
  • Keep tasting! Adjust lime and salt until it’s just right for your palate.

Spicy Watermelon Salad with Fresh Cilantro and Lime

Ingredients You’ll Need:

For the Salad:

  • 4 cups seedless watermelon, cut into bite-sized cubes
  • 1/2 cup fresh cilantro leaves, roughly chopped
  • 1 small red chili (such as Fresno or serrano), finely chopped (adjust to spice preference)
  • 1/4 cup red onion, thinly sliced

For the Dressing:

  • 1 lime, juiced
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1/2 teaspoon chili powder or cayenne pepper
  • Salt to taste

Optional Additions:

  • 1/4 cup crumbled feta cheese or
  • diced cucumber for extra freshness

How Much Time Will You Need?

This delightful salad takes about 10 minutes to prepare! You’ll need an additional 15-20 minutes to chill it in the refrigerator. That’s just enough time for the flavors to blend perfectly!

Step-by-Step Instructions:

1. Prepare the Watermelon:

Begin by placing the bite-sized watermelon cubes in a large mixing bowl. The watermelon is the star of this dish, so make sure they’re nice and juicy!

2. Add the Fresh Ingredients:

Next, add in the chopped cilantro, finely chopped red chili, and thinly sliced red onion. This mix of ingredients adds a lovely crunch and flavor to the salad.

3. Whisk the Dressing:

In a small bowl, whisk together the lime juice, olive oil, chili powder, and a pinch of salt. This zesty dressing will brighten the flavors of the salad!

4. Combine Everything:

Pour the dressing over the watermelon mixture. Gently toss everything together to ensure the watermelon is evenly coated with the dressing and all the flavors mingle beautifully!

5. Taste and Adjust:

Give your salad a little taste. If you want more spice, adjust the chili or add a pinch more salt as needed.

6. Optional Additions:

If you’re using feta cheese or diced cucumber, gently fold them into the salad now for some added creaminess and freshness.

7. Chill Before Serving:

Cover the salad and place it in the refrigerator for at least 15-20 minutes. This allows all the flavors to meld together beautifully!

8. Serve and Enjoy:

Serve the salad chilled as a refreshing side dish or snack. Enjoy the burst of flavors that’s perfect for summer!

Can I Use Different Fruits in This Salad?

Absolutely! While watermelon is the star, you can experiment with other fruits like pineapple, mango, or cantaloupe for a tasty twist. Just make sure to adjust the dressing and spices to match the fruit’s flavor!

How Can I Make This Salad Ahead of Time?

You can prep this salad in advance! However, it’s best to assemble the salad just a few hours before serving. If you’re making it ahead, mix the dressing separately and combine it with the watermelon just before serving to keep it fresh.

How Do I Store Leftover Salad?

Store any leftover salad in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. However, keep in mind that the watermelon might release some juice, so it’s best to enjoy it fresh!

What Can I Serve This Salad With?

This salad pairs beautifully with grilled meats, seafood, or as a light, refreshing side for tacos. It’s also a great addition to any summer picnic or barbecue!
